Prepare For The Storm
When I came to campus this year, my plan was simple: get a job before January and make 100k birr before I graduate.
I started the journey in October (Tikimt), working on some full-stack projects like a YouTube clone, a social media app, and later a business analytics + project management system (deployed).
During this time, I made it to the advanced interview stage twiceβ¦ but couldnβt proceed because the jobs required onsite work. I was in Bahir Dar, and the jobs were in Addis Ababa.
These past few weeks, I saw the #200kBirr90DayChallenge by Cyber Guardians. It reminded me of the plan I made when I first came to campus⦠and honestly, I had already abandoned it.
Time is moving fast, and I wasnβt consistent enough to turn my dream into reality.
Then I thought⦠why not try again?
Better late than never.
At this point, I havenβt made a single penny from my web development skills. Sounds crazy, right? Planning to make 100k birr without even landing my first gig.
But what if I donβt make it?
Nothing happens. I lose nothing.
Instead, I become:
1 more consistent
2 more disciplined
3 a harder worker and
4 improve my technical skills (big win)
Even if I fail⦠I still win.
Hereβs my plan to make 100k birr before graduation:
1 Reach out to local clients (hotels, cafΓ©s, restaurants, stores, and other businesses)
2 Use Upwork (I already have a verified account)
3 Post my projects on LinkedIn (even if theyβre small) and apply actively
4 Reach out to tech companies and try to get hired
Iβll try every possible way to achieve this goal.
Since Iβm a graduating student, there are also responsibilities I canβt ignore:
1 Classes
2 Final exams
3 Final year project
4 Exit exam
5 Events I should be part of as a GC student (these moments wonβt come againβI have to enjoy them too)
Balancing all of thisβ¦ thatβs part of the challenge.
Daily reflection questions:
1 Whatβs my main focus today?
2 Whatβs currently blocking or slowing me down?
3 What did I learn today?
To be specific, there are 88 days left until graduation.
Iβll dedicate 80 days to this challenge and finish one week before graduation.
Iβll prioritize this challenge while still balancing my social life.
Thereβs nothing to lose.
Even if I fail, Iβll gain so much from the journey.
So⦠why not try it?
